Not out of the woods yet...

This is SO not the post that I have been planning to write for the last week. Because Miss Georgia was doing awesome. She was running and jumping and playing so hard that she actually would look up at me and wonderingly say, "Mama...my legs hurt?" Because her heart had always worn out before her legs had a chance to tire. It has been incredible.
   Then on Saturday I found her slumped in the corner of her room looking super pale with big dark circles under her eyes...and she said her chest hurt. I scooped her up and grabbed the pulse oximeter. Her heart rate was in the 40-50 range (her normal resting rate is 80-90s), her oxygen was at 80. I tried the machine over and over to make sure it was working right. We curled up on her bed and I watched those darned numbers. After a few minutes her rates slowly went back up. She then looked at me and said, "I'm just so tired Mama."...and put herself to bed in the middle of the afternoon for 45 minutes.
...so we're back to scratching our heads. The on call Cardiologist thinks she was having Bradycadia and that possibly the surgery threw her heart rhythms out of whack. She seems pretty good now (more tired and cranky than normal) and has not had another episode like that but tomorrow we are running in to the Cardiologist to get another 48 hour Holter monitor in hopes of catching whatever is going on....so once again, would you mind praying?
